是指在前端开发中,通过JavaScript代码来获取选中的复选框的值,并进行相应的计算或处理操作。以下是完善且全面的答案:
复选框(Checkbox)是一种HTML表单元素,允许用户从多个选项中选择一个或多个选项。在JavaScript中,可以通过以下步骤来计算复选框的值:
document.querySelectorAll()
方法,传入复选框元素的选择器,例如input[type="checkbox"]
,可以获取到页面中所有的复选框元素。checked
属性判断是否选中,若选中则可以通过value
属性获取其值。以下是一个示例代码,演示如何计算选中复选框的值并进行累加计算:
// 获取所有复选框元素
var checkboxes = document.querySelectorAll('input[type="checkbox"]');
// 初始化计算结果
var sum = 0;
// 遍历复选框元素
checkboxes.forEach(function(checkbox) {
// 判断复选框是否选中
if (checkbox.checked) {
// 获取选中复选框的值,并转换为数字
var value = parseInt(checkbox.value);
// 累加计算
sum += value;
}
});
// 输出计算结果
console.log(sum);
该示例代码中,首先通过document.querySelectorAll()
方法获取所有的复选框元素,并使用forEach()
方法遍历这些元素。然后通过判断复选框的checked
属性来确定是否选中,若选中则获取其值并进行累加计算。最后输出计算结果。
该方法适用于多个复选框的场景,可以方便地获取选中复选框的值并进行相应的计算或处理。在实际应用中,可以根据具体业务需求进行进一步的开发和优化。
推荐腾讯云相关产品:腾讯云云函数(SCF)
腾讯云云函数(Serverless Cloud Function,SCF)是一种无服务器计算服务,可以在腾讯云上运行代码而无需管理服务器。您可以使用腾讯云云函数轻松构建和运行事件驱动型的应用程序和服务。
腾讯云云函数产品介绍:腾讯云云函数(SCF)
领取专属 10元无门槛券
手把手带您无忧上云